首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何绑定SQL query和GetMapping

绑定SQL query和GetMapping是指在后端开发中,将SQL查询语句与GetMapping请求方法进行绑定,以实现根据请求参数执行相应的SQL查询操作。

在实际开发中,可以使用Spring框架提供的注解来实现绑定。具体步骤如下:

  1. 首先,确保项目中已经引入了Spring框架的相关依赖。
  2. 在后端的Controller层中,使用@GetMapping注解标注一个处理HTTP GET请求的方法。
  3. 在该方法的参数列表中,使用@RequestParam注解来获取请求中的参数,并将其传递给SQL查询语句。
  4. 在方法体内,使用JDBC或者ORM框架执行SQL查询操作,并将结果返回给前端。

下面是一个示例代码:

代码语言:txt
复制
import org.springframework.web.bind.annotation.GetMapping;
import org.springframework.web.bind.annotation.RequestParam;
import org.springframework.web.bind.annotation.RestController;

@RestController
public class MyController {

    @GetMapping("/data")
    public String getData(@RequestParam("param") String param) {
        // 将param参数传递给SQL查询语句,执行查询操作
        // ...
        // 返回查询结果
        return "data";
    }
}

在上述示例中,我们使用@GetMapping注解标注了一个处理GET请求的方法,该方法的路径为"/data"。通过@RequestParam注解,我们获取了名为"param"的请求参数,并将其传递给SQL查询语句进行查询操作。最后,将查询结果返回给前端。

绑定SQL query和GetMapping的优势在于可以通过简单的注解配置,实现灵活的SQL查询操作,并将查询结果直接返回给前端。这样可以减少开发工作量,提高开发效率。

该方法适用于需要根据不同的请求参数执行不同的SQL查询操作的场景,例如根据用户ID查询用户信息、根据关键字搜索商品等。

腾讯云提供了多种云计算相关产品,其中与数据库和后端开发相关的产品包括云数据库 TencentDB、云函数 SCF、云服务器 CVM 等。您可以根据具体需求选择适合的产品进行开发和部署。

  • 腾讯云数据库 TencentDB:提供多种数据库类型,包括关系型数据库(MySQL、SQL Server、PostgreSQL等)和NoSQL数据库(MongoDB、Redis等)。详情请参考:腾讯云数据库
  • 云函数 SCF:无服务器计算服务,可用于编写和运行后端代码,支持多种编程语言。详情请参考:云函数 SCF
  • 云服务器 CVM:提供虚拟服务器实例,可用于搭建后端环境和部署应用程序。详情请参考:云服务器 CVM

以上是腾讯云提供的一些相关产品,您可以根据具体需求选择适合的产品进行开发和部署。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

没有搜到相关的合辑

领券